banklagu.com Open ↗ Has Plan
71
DOM 85 PLN 55 REV 55 EAS 90
CLAUDE.md ×
D1-GOTCHAS.md ×
LEGAL-REFERENCE.md ×
SESSION-NOTES.md ×
package-lock.json ×
package.json ×
plan.md
PREVIEW

banklagu.com — Platform Distribusi Musik Indonesia

Status: Live

Pitch

Platform distribusi musik untuk artis independen, label rekaman, dan pencipta lagu Indonesia. Distribusikan musik ke Spotify, Apple Music, YouTube Music, TikTok Music, Deezer, JOOX, Amazon Music dan 150+ platform streaming/download global dari satu dashboard.

Live Deployment

  • Source: /home/ucok/web/banklagu.com/ — CF Worker
  • Stack: CF Worker + D1 (banklagu-db) + R2 (banklagu-media) + KV (SESSIONS, CACHE, RATE_LIMIT, CONFIG) + Workers AI
  • Custom domain: banklagu.com, www.banklagu.com
  • Worker: banklagu-com (src/index.js)
  • Architecture: 100% Cloudflare (no server dependencies)

Core Features

  • Distribusi ke 150+ DSP — Spotify, Apple, YouTube Music, TikTok Music, JOOX, Deezer, Amazon, Pandora, Tidal, Anghami, dll.
  • Royalty splits — bagi otomatis ke kolaborator, sesi musisi, producer berdasarkan persentase
  • Cover art generator (AI) — Workers AI bikin artwork dari prompt + nama track
  • Pre-save & smart links — landing page per rilis dengan tracking
  • Analytics dashboard — stream, royalty, listener demographics, top markets
  • Content ID — claim YouTube revenue dari user-generated content
  • Mastering AI — quick LANDR-like mastering via Workers AI / partner API

Target Audience

  • Musisi indie Indonesia tanpa label
  • Label rekaman kecil-menengah dengan katalog terbatas
  • Pencipta lagu dan komposer (publishing-focused)
  • Producer beats yang ingin upload ke streaming
  • Genre niche Indonesia: dangdut, koplo, religi, lokal-regional

Revenue Model

Stream Mechanics Monthly est.
Annual subscription Rp 250K-500K/tahun unlimited release $500-$3,000
Per-release fee Rp 50K-100K/single, Rp 150K-300K/album $300-$1,500
Royalty cut (revenue share) 10-15% of streaming revenue $200-$2,000
AI mastering & artwork upsell Rp 25K-100K per use $100-$500
Featured placement & promo Curator submission fees $50-$300
Total ~$1,150-$7,300

Target Metrics

  • 1,000-10,000 active artists
  • 5,000-50,000 active releases
  • 100M-1B streams across catalog/year (revenue cut basis)
  • 20-40% MoM growth in first 12 months
  • Net Revenue Retention > 100% (artists upgrade and stay)

SEO Strategy

  • Long-tail: "cara distribusi lagu ke spotify", "DistroKid Indonesia", "submit lagu ke apple music", "royalti musik streaming", "platform rilis musik indonesia"
  • City-specific landing: "studio rekaman jakarta", "produser beat surabaya"
  • Genre hubs: dangdut distribution, religi distribution
  • Comparison content: vs DistroKid, vs TuneCore, vs Amuse

Tech Notes

  • D1 for catalog, royalty splits, payouts
  • R2 for audio files, artwork, lyrics, splits documents
  • KV for session, rate-limit, cache
  • Workers AI for cover art generation + mastering
  • Sessions: JWT signed, refresh in KV
  • Integration with DSP ingestion APIs (Spotify API, Apple Music for Artists, YouTube Content ID)

Competitive Advantage

  • Indonesia-first — IDR pricing, bahasa Indonesia UI, payment via lokal channels (DANA, OVO, GoPay, bank transfer)
  • Lower fees than global incumbents — DistroKid $20/yr equivalent priced for Indonesian market
  • Edge-served dashboard — sub-100ms latency for Indonesian users
  • AI features baked-in — artwork, mastering tanpa biaya ekstra

Important Notes

  • Live and active
  • Royalty payouts WAJIB akurat — financial integrity = trust
  • DSP API compliance (Spotify's, Apple's terms) harus dijaga

⚙ HARD CONSTRAINTS (enforced for all sites)

This domain MUST operate within these constraints — no exceptions:

  • 100% Cloudflare serverless — Workers + D1 + R2 + KV + Workers AI + Vectorize. NEVER PM2, NEVER VPS, NEVER Docker in production path.
  • 100% AI-automated — every customer interaction, every moderation decision, every transaction reconcile = AI. No manual queue, no live human chat support, no physical fulfillment.
  • 1-operator solo — one person can run the entire operation from a phone. No team meetings, no shared inbox, no shift rotation.
  • WhatsApp AI bot for all support (24/7, instant response, no SLA promises that need humans).
  • Mayar QRIS for all Indonesian payments (subscription auto-renew, no manual invoicing).
  • Indonesian UI primary — bahasa-first, English fallback only where unavoidable.
  • Privacy — opt-in only, delete-on-request honored within 24h (cron-driven).
  • No physical goods, no inventory — digital products + affiliate referrals only.

If the plan above describes any flow that violates these constraints, treat the plan as ASPIRATIONAL only and rework before building. The constraint trifecta wins.

AI ASSISTANT

Ask AI to research, improve, or generate content.

Try: "Research competitors for this niche"

Actions